Ruelle
Pronunciation: roo-EL
Meaning
small street, alley
Origin
French
About Ruelle
Ruelle offers an uncommon elegance, evoking images of charming European pathways and a whisper of romantic adventure. This name, with its Old French roots meaning "small street" or "alley," carries a distinctive, sophisticated air without feeling ostentatious. It's a perfect choice for parents who appreciate a name that is both rare and refined, suggesting a child with an artistic spirit and an individualistic streak. Unlike many soft-sounding names, Ruelle has a subtle strength and an intriguing, almost poetic, quality that sets it apart. It’s a name that feels both established and refreshingly modern, ideal for those seeking a unique identity for their daughter.
